Reduces condensation

Double glazing can be an excellent way to save energy however it also creates condensation. Mold can grow when the moisture in the window panes gets held in. This could cause serious health problems for you and your family It is therefore essential to get rid of the condensation as soon as possible. You can use a blow-dryer to dry your windows. This is a temporary solution. The best method to get rid of the condensation is to replace the double glazing.

It is crucial to engage a professional to fix the misty glass window. It's not a good idea to attempt to fix the window on your own. You could seriously injure yourself or damage the structure of your home. Additionally, you might not have the tools necessary to complete the task. A professional glazier has the tools and expertise required to operate your windows in a safe manner.

In certain cases condensation in double-glazing can be due to a defect in the sealant. This could be due to the sealant was applied incorrectly or is of poor quality in the factory. If this occurs, the inert gas in the double-glazed glass will begin to evaporate. The glass will then turn cloudy and its energy efficiency will be lost.

A glazier could fix this problem by replacing all double-glazed glass units. The glazier first needs to drain any moisture from the window. Then, he will scrub the surface of the glass and reseal it. Depending on the kind of window, he may be required to replace the sash or frames. In the majority of cases the cost of replacing the window is lower than the cost of fixing an air-tight seal that has been blown out.

A glazier will also ensure that the air gap is sealed between the window panes. To accomplish this, he'll drill an opening in the window and spray a cleaning solution in the gap. Then, he will wait a few days for the moisture to completely dry. When the moisture is gone, the glazier puts on an anti-fog and vents the window.

It's possible to replace your window glass for various reasons, ranging from severe scratches to condensation between two panes. The best choice is to replace the broken glass with an IGU or insulated glass unit. The installer will remove the damaged window, clean up the frame, and then put in and seal the new IGU. They'll also caulk and strip the window to ensure a secure seal.

The seals between the glass in a double-glazed window can become damaged over time, causing condensation and mist. You may be able to repair the seal rather than replace the entire window in the event that this happens. This is usually cheaper and quicker, and could save money over time.

It is worth upgrading to toughened glass in the event of replacing a double-glazed pane. It's five times stronger and more resistant to impacts and shattering than laminated standard. This type of glass is typically more expensive than laminated standard glass, but it's a safe choice for your family's safety and security.
